A man is due in court today (Thursday) charged with producing class B drugs after police found a cannabis factory in Bretton.

The Neighbourhood Support Team carried out a warrant in Benland yesterday morning (Wednesday) where they discovered 122 cannabis plants worth up to about £102,000.
Erenik Seremi, 30, of no fixed address, was arrested and has since been charged with producing cannabis and abstracting electricity.
He has been remanded in custody to appear at Cambridge Magistrates’ Court today.
